
Artists: Techno Mama
Release: Starlight Fever
Label: Groove Mama
BPM: 130
Date: 2025-09-05
Style: Techno (Peak Time / Driving)

Artists: Techno Mama
Release: Starlight Fever
Label: Groove Mama
BPM: 130
Date: 2025-09-05
Style: Techno (Peak Time / Driving)